JOB SUMMARY
We are looking for a mid-level React JavaScript Developer who values exploration, discovery, efficiency, and finding solutions to complex issues. Working closely with our team of developers, engineers, operators, and NASA customers, you’ll design and develop new features to support Worldview ((Use the "Apply for this Job" box below).), an open‑source web application () for interactively visualizing and mapping full‑resolution imagery from NASA’s Earth observing satellites. You’ll support thousands of scientists, educators, first responders, journalists, and others across the globe who use Worldview every day for their mission.
